Heads up for the reviewer: the Burrowmill message queue runs log compaction every six hours, and compacted segments get re-signed with the active custodial key. During the ceremony we rotate that key, so any segment compacted mid-rotation needs a manual re-sign — check the compactor dashboard shows zero in-flight jobs before proceeding. Two witnesses must initial this step. The sealed envelope for this step contains the recovery passphrase, reproduced here for the ceremony record.

vault phrase of tajef-tafog = istox-sorax-zorox-casok-holox-kelix-weneth-drueth-casion

## Bramblepay Environments

Integration tests against the sandbox gateway flake roughly twice a week, usually on settlement callbacks. Retries are enabled; don't re-run the whole suite by hand. If a test fails three times, file it under the flaky-tests label and move on. The sandbox environment runs with the settings listed below.

config for kafof-bawef:
holath:
  log_level: debug
  metrics_host: metrics.holath.qorvelsys.internal
  pin: 2191
  pool_size: 32

## Northvale Region — Q3 Sales Review (Managers Only)

Sales leads should note that Northvale's Q3 performance trailed forecast by a modest margin, driven largely by slower renewals on the Calderix product line. The Westbrook and Harlowe territories outperformed, offsetting weakness in Drummond Flats. Pipeline quality remains sound, though conversion timelines have lengthened. Please review your territory summaries before Friday's call. The confidential planning note below is shared with managers only.

confidential, fahag-yahap: Project Raleth slips by six weeks because of the tooling delay.

Ticket: Stale-cache postmortem follow-up (Fernhollow staging). Root cause: the cache invalidation worker ran without its broker credential, so purge messages were silently dropped and pages served stale content for six hours. Fix is config-only. Contractors: do not copy prod env files into staging. Set the TTL back to 300 and ensure the worker env file contains the line below.

vault entry, yahif-yajep: COURIER_KEY29=b802bdf8034096b65a51c6ba5abe2